Is Filipino Menudo the same as Mexican Menudo?

Filipino menudo is a stew made with pork and liver chunks and a tomato-based sauce while Mexican menudo is a traditional soup featuring beef tripe and a red chili pepper based-broth. It is herbier and spicier than the Filipino menudo as it includes oregano and cumin as well.

What is Filipino Menudo made of?

Menudo, also known as ginamay or ginagmay (Cebuano: “[chopped into] smaller pieces”), is a traditional stew from the Philippines made with pork and sliced liver in tomato sauce with carrots and potatoes. Unlike the Mexican dish of the same name, it does not use tripe or red chili sauce.

What is the difference between Menudo and Igado?

Igado uses pork sliced into strips. One look at both dishes will tell you what is served: if the pork pieces have been cut into small cubes, chances are the dish is a menudo. If you see pork strips along with the bell peppers, it’s igado.

What is pork Menudo made of?

In the U.S., menudo usually refers to a spicy Mexican soup made with chunks of tripe in a chili-infused broth. However, the recipe here is the Filipino version, a colorful stew of pork or chicken, liver, potatoes, carrots, bell peppers, garbanzo beans, and raisins in rich tomato gravy.

What is menudo called in English?

In Mexican cuisine, Menudo, also known as pancita ([little] gut or [little] stomach) or mole de panza (“stomach sauce”), is a traditional Mexican soup, made with cow’s stomach (tripe) in broth with a red chili pepper base.

What country eats menudo?

Although menudo hails from Mexico, southwestern United States residents have adopted the dish, and it’s widely served at Mexican restaurants across the region – though often to mixed reviews. Those who love the dish often grew up eating the stew, which is also known as pancita or mole de panza.

What’s the difference between menudo and pozole?

Posole and Menudo are both traditional Mexican soups made with hominy. The main difference between the two soups is the meat used to make these soup recipes. Pozole is made with pork (pozole de puerco or pozole rojo) and sometimes chicken. On the other hand, Menudo is made with tripe (cow stomach).

What does menudo mean in Tagalog?

Definition for the Tagalog word menudo:

menudo. [noun] a tomato based stew with pork or beef tripe.

What part of meat is used in menudo?

The Mexican version is soup-based, it is not a stew. They also use tripe and chilies as their main ingredient while our version uses sliced pork meat and liver. Common vegetables like potatoes, bell pepper, and carrots are used.

Is Caldereta and menudo the same?

Menudo, also known as ginamay, is a traditional stew from the Philippines made with pork and sliced liver in tomato sauce with carrots and potatoes. Kaldereta or caldereta is a goat meat stew from the Philippines. Variations of the dish use beef, chicken, or pork.

What is the difference between Menudo mechado and Afritada?

Afritada —derived from the Spanish word ‘fritada’ meaning to fry — features chicken in pure tomato sauce, and embellished by carrots, potatoes and bell pepper. Mechado meanwhile has either pork or beef in tomato sauce, plus vinegar, soy sauce, carrots and potatoes.
